- Geoffrey De Marisco a nephew of Strongbow built the Castleisland castle in 1215. He gave it to his sister Ellenor as a dowry on her marriage to the Earl of Desmond. At that time Ufford was Lord Lieutenant of Ireland and he summoned a Parliament in Dublin. The Earl refused to attend it and summoned a rivel parliament in Callan. Ufford said he would conquer the Earl so he marched to Callan with his soldiers but the Earl was not there. Finally they marched to Castleisland and attacked his castle.
